I started Downwind in late 2008 shortly after I received my PPL at the Royal Victorian Aeroclub at Moorabbin Airport in Victoria. I found that I really wanted to share about my own experiences as a new pilot and learn from other pilots so that my aviation knowledge would continue to grow after the formal training. As with all things on the Internet Downwind has continued to expand more pilots have joined in the community and contributed everything from their own blogs, photos, advice and an enormous amount of experience. All of which is good!

MG_Profile_160My wife Roselyn contributes to Downwind and loves writing about flying from a wife and passengers perspective. I find that her articles are often reflect what us poor pilots put our passengers through!

Both Roselyn and I founded Downwind on the premise of "Do unto others as you would have them do unto you" which means that if you want some advice then make sure that you also help out others. It's the old adage of what goes around comes around. So make sure that you're courteous in the forums.

As I continue to enjoy my aviation passion  I hope that you enjoy Downwind and associating with a great group of pilots that have a desire to both be safe and have fun in the air.
